Axis and Allies is a strategic board game series that simulates the military and economic struggles of World War II. Players take control of major world powers—either the Axis or Allied nations—and aim to dominate the globe through tactical battles, production planning, and long-term strategy.
The series includes numerous editions such as Axis and Allies 1942, 1940 Europe, 1940 Pacific, D-Day, Battle of the Bulge, and Global 1940. Each version has its own map, units, and strategic depth, with Global combining both 1940 games into a massive, immersive experience.
Most Axis and Allies games support 2–5 players, with each player taking on the role of a specific nation. Some editions can be played with fewer players controlling multiple powers, while larger versions like Global 1940 are best with a full group for the most balanced experience.
Gameplay combines resource management, military tactics, and global strategy. Players must balance production, movement, and combat across land, sea, and air while coordinating with allies or disrupting enemy plans. Turns are structured yet dynamic, offering high replay value and strategic depth.
While Axis and Allies has a moderate learning curve, it's approachable with guidance or tutorials. The 1941 and 1942 editions are great entry points for new players, offering streamlined gameplay while still delivering the core strategic experience. Veteran players often gravitate toward the more complex 1940 Global format.
Most Axis and Allies sets include a game board map, plastic miniatures representing infantry, tanks, planes, ships, industrial complexes, rulebooks, dice, national control markers, and IPC (Industrial Production Certificates) used for in-game economy. The components are tailored to the edition's historical theater.
Axis and Allies combines accessible mechanics with deep strategic options, blending historical flavor with engaging team-based gameplay. It has stood the test of time as a gateway into historical board gaming and remains a staple for those who enjoy grand strategy and cooperative planning.
